Since November 2021, the cryptocurrency market has lost over $1 trillion in value, leading some investors to consider buying the dip. However, the most severe risks for crypto investments may still lie ahead. Here are five critical reasons long-term investors should exercise caution.


1. Bitcoin’s Risk-Adjusted Returns Are "Underwhelming"

In its early stages, Bitcoin exhibited near-zero correlation with stocks and commodities, offering true portfolio diversification. However, post-2020, Bitcoin’s correlation with U.S. equities and bonds surged dramatically.

While high volatility could be justified by substantial returns, Bitcoin’s risk-adjusted performance since 2018 has been lackluster compared to traditional assets.

FAQs

Q1: Is now a good time to invest in cryptocurrencies?
A1: Short-term volatility may persist, but long-term uncertainties (regulation, ESG, CBDCs) advise caution.

Q2: How do CBDCs threaten stablecoins?
A2: CBDCs provide state-backed stability, rendering private stablecoins unnecessary.

Q3: Can Bitcoin regain its "digital gold" status?
A3: Only if it proves inflation-resistant in future crises—currently unverified.
